  • Patent number: 6940027
    Abstract: A locking assembly is for a circuit breaker including an enclosure and an operating handle operable between a first, ON position and a second, OFF position with respect to the enclosure. The operating handle includes a first aperture extending therethrough. The locking assembly includes a stationary element coupled to the enclosure and includes a second aperture extending therethrough. The second aperture corresponds with the first aperture of the operating handle when aligned therewith. A blocking element coupled to the operating handle blocks the second aperture when the operating handle is disposed in any position other than the second, OFF position in which the first aperture extending through the operating handle is aligned with the second aperture of the stationary element. A lock is inserted through the aligned apertures in order to lock the operating handle in the second, OFF position.

  • Patent number: 4724512
    Abstract: A pair of slides (20,22) linearly reciprocally movable in opposite directions by a single operator handle (36) carry pins (24,26) which are received within dog-leg slots (14a,14b; 14a',14b') of levers (14,14') affixed to rotary operating mechanisms (6,6') of repsective ones of a pair of switches (4,4') for operating one switch to an ON condition while maintaining the other switch in its OFF condition in response to handle (36) movement in one direction, and for operating the switches to their reverse conditions in response to handle movement in an opposite direction, both switches being in their OFF condition in a center neutral position of the handle. Fuses (40,42) are connected to load side terminals of the switches and are connected together in common with the load to remove power from the fuses when the switches are OFF.
